nn-inplace-rs

Crates.ionn-inplace-rs
lib.rsnn-inplace-rs
version0.1.0
created_at2026-01-08 04:56:53.481951+00
updated_at2026-01-08 04:56:53.481951+00
descriptionOptimized NN library for embedded devices.
homepage
repository
max_upload_size
id2029557
size179,510
giangndm (giangndm)

documentation

README

Inplace Operation for Neural Network

This repo implements simple neural network inference which optimized for CPU / embeded. Instead of create new tensor everytime, it uses inplace operation to reduce memory usage.

Optimize

Use nkf_aec as example, run 10000 times for measure.

Version Fps
First 2649
Vec Dot SIMD & Vec Mul SIMD 3193
Vec Sigmoid SIMD 4490
Vec Add, Sub, Mul SIMD 4560
GRU Fused 4698
Commit count: 0

cargo fmt